Tasks

-Plan and design temporary structures, following construction and government standards, using design software, and drawing tools. -Review status reports for management, client, and others. -Review project proposals and plans to determine time frame, funding limitations, procedures, project staffing requirements, and allotment of available resources. -Will climb ladders, work at heights, walk and stand on uneven surfaces, ride or work from a barge, pier, vessel, etc. -Confer with project staff to outline work plans and to assign duties, responsibilities, and scope of authority. -Develop and maintain resource-loaded project schedules. -Formulation of technical proposals, including technical means and methods, schedules, and pricing. -Organize and manage subcontractors. -Act as a Quality Control/Quality Assurance representative as required. -Assist the overall direction, coordination, and evaluation of the project, including safety, performance, budget, scheduling, equipment management, and quality. -Work with, and be part of, the estimating departments during project procurement phases. -Coordinate project activities with Ballard personnel, subcontractors, and joint venture partners. -Carry out supervisory responsibilities in accordance with the organization’s policies and applicable laws. -May act as the Ballard’s lead representative in the absence of the Project Manager. -Direct and coordinate activities of project personnel to ensure project progresses on schedule and within the prescribed budget.

About Ballard Marine Construction

-Today, the company delivers turnkey underwater, marine and infrastructure projects—spanning tunnels, pipelines, dams, floating docks, and rail and bridge work. -Their expertise extends across energy, industrial, water, transportation and environmental sectors, often with cutting-edge hyperbaric, robotics and survey support. -Projects range from tunnel repairs (SR99), dam stabilization (Strontia Springs), to complex dredging and salvage jobs (Dutchman Slough, M/V Tiffany). -The company’s fleet of specialized equipment and rapid-response teams enable global mobilization for technically challenging marine assignments. -They continue a legacy of bold innovation—combining diving, engineering and construction to push boundaries beneath the water’s surface.
